We're looking for a talented and experienced Lead BI Developer to join our team! In this role, you'll be a key player in transforming business needs into powerful reporting and analytics solutions. You'll partner closely with our Finance, Sales & Marketing, and Operations teams, leveraging your expertise to design, develop, implement, and transform business requirements into powerful, scalable, and high-performing applications. You will be a technical expert responsible for guiding the design, development, and support of our enterprise reporting and visualization solutions.
Preferred Qualifications- Partner with business analysts and functional stakeholders across diverse departments to understand reporting and analytics requirements; lead solution design, create mock-ups, and translate needs into scalable reporting models and intuitive visualizations.
- Design, develop, and maintain robust, scalable semantic models, data layers, and reporting architectures adhering to enterprise best practices and governance standards.
- Develop, optimize, and maintain data transformation and load scripts, orchestrating Implement and manage granular data access security, including Role-Level Security (RLS) in Power BI or Section Access in QlikView.
- Provide ongoing enhancements and production support; proactively troubleshoot, diagnose, and resolve data bottlenecks, refresh failures, and calculation latencies with a sense of urgency.
- Lead code reviews, enforce coding and architectural standards, and mentor junior-to-mid-level developers to foster technical excellence and continuous improvement.
- Participate in our Scrum process, taking end-to-end ownership of Jira user stories from conception through to production rollout.

What We Do
Brady Corporation is an international manufacturer and marketer of complete solutions that identify and protect people, products and places. Brady’s products help customers increase safety, security, productivity and performance and include high-performance labels, signs, safety devices, printing systems and software. Founded in 1914, the Company has a diverse customer base in electronics, telecommunications, manufacturing, electrical, construction, medical, aerospace and a variety of other industries. Brady is headquartered in Milwaukee, Wisconsin and as of July 31, 2021, employed approximately 5,700 people in its worldwide businesses. Brady’s fiscal 2021 sales were approximately $1.14 billion.
